18-year-old arrested after Arcadia Lake shooting in Edmond
Edmond police arrested an 18-year-old following the Arcadia Lake shooting on May 3, 2026, that left one woman dead and 22 others wounded. The arrest took place on Wednesday, May 6, 2026, as authorities moved to upgrade charges after the victim succumbed to her injuries. Police say the incident began with an altercation at a late-night gathering and escalated into gunfire amid a large crowd.
Arrest in Edmond after Arcadia Lake shooting
Edmond Police announced the arrest of an 18-year-old identified as Jilan A. Davis during a Wednesday press briefing. Davis was initially detained on an assault-with-a-deadly-weapon charge and remains in custody as prosecutors review the evidence. Police confirmed they are preparing to file a homicide charge following the death of an 18-year-old woman injured in the shooting.
Authorities say charges upgraded following victim’s death
Police officials told reporters that the assault charge is being elevated after the injured woman, identified as Avianna Smith-Gray, died from her wounds. Edmond Police Chief J.D. Younger outlined that the medical examiner’s findings and witness accounts prompted the decision to pursue a more serious charge. Investigators emphasized that formal charging documents will reflect the updated classification once finalized by the district attorney’s office.
Shooting occurred at late-night party at Arcadia Lake
According to law enforcement, the shooting took place on Sunday evening, May 3, 2026, at a gathering near Arcadia Lake, a recreational area north of Oklahoma City. A dispute between two women reportedly sparked tensions that spread through the crowd, prompting an exchange of gunfire in a crowded space. Officials said the large number of attendees and the chaotic scene complicated early investigative efforts and emergency response.
Victim identified; 22 others injured
Edmond Police confirmed the identity of the deceased as Avianna Smith-Gray, 18, and reported that 22 additional people sustained injuries during the incident. Authorities have not provided a detailed breakdown of the injured, including ages or the severity of wounds, but said multiple victims were transported to area hospitals. Medical teams and first responders remained on scene in the hours after the shooting to treat and transfer those affected.
Police search for at least one additional suspect
Investigators said at least one other suspect remains at large and that efforts to locate additional persons of interest are ongoing. Chief Younger urged anyone with video, photos or firsthand information to come forward to assist the probe, stressing the importance of community cooperation. Law enforcement also appealed to social media users to share any material directly with police rather than circulating unverified footage.
Investigation, evidence, and community safety measures
Authorities reported that ballistic and forensic teams are processing the scene and analysing recovered evidence to establish a clear sequence of events. Detectives are interviewing witnesses and reviewing any available surveillance or cellphone footage to corroborate statements. Local officials said patrols in the Arcadia Lake area would be increased while the investigation continues and highlighted plans to coordinate with state resources if needed.
